Experimental Results for the study "A Modular Hybridization of Particle Swarm Optimization and Differential Evolution"

<p>This repository contains the experiment results and R scripts to analyze the data for the study &quot;A Modular Hybridization of Particle Swarm Optimization andDifferential Evolution&quot;, which is accepted in <em>The Genetic and Evolutionary Computation Conference</em> (GECCO) &#39;20 conference:&nbsp;</p> <p>Rick Boks, Hao Wang, and Thomas B&auml;ck. 2020. A Modular Hybridization of Particle Swarm Optimization and Differential Evolution. In <em>Genetic and Evolutionary Computation Conference Companion (GECCO &rsquo;20 Companion), July 8&ndash;12, 2020, Canc&uacute;n, Mexico. </em>ACM, New York, NY, USA, 8 pages. <a href="http://https: //doi.org/10.1145/3377929.3398123">https: //doi.org/10.1145/3377929.3398123</a></p> <p>Bibtex:</p> <pre><code class="language-markdown">@inproceedings{BoksWB20, author = {Rick Boks and Hao Wang and Thomas B\"ack}, title = {{A Modular Hybridization of Particle Swarm Optimization and Differential Evolution}}, booktitle = {Proceedings of the Genetic and Evolutionary Computation Conference, {GECCO} 2020, Canc\'un, Mexico, July 8-12, 2020}, publisher = {{ACM}}, year = {2020}, url = {https://doi.org/10.1145/3321707.3321816}, doi = {doi.org/10.1145/3377929.3398123, }</code></pre> <p><strong>Data description:</strong> we benchmarked <strong>800 </strong>different<strong>&nbsp;</strong>hybridizations of&nbsp;the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O) and Differential Evolution (DE) algorithms on a well-known continuous black-box problem set called <a href="https://coco.gforge.inria.fr/">COCO/BBOB</a>, which consists of 24 test functions. 30 independent runs are conducted for each algorithm on each problem.</p> <ul> <li>&#39;ERT.csv&#39;: a data frame with columns DIM (5D or 20D), funcId (F1-24), algId (algorithm names), target (<span class="math-tex">\(10^{\{-8,-7, \ldots, 1\}}\)</span>), ERT (expected running time), and sd (standard deviation).</li> <li>&#39;raw-data.csv&#39;: the running time recorded in each independent run.&nbsp;</li> <li>&#39;analysis.R&#39;: the R script that generates ERT tables in the paper.</li> <li>&#39;ecdf.R&#39;: the R script that renders the ECDF (empirical cumulative distribution function) plots in the paper.</li> </ul>

Figures -using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O)-An Optimized Clustering Approach for Automated Detection of White Matter Lesions in MRI Brain Images

<p>The performance of WML quantification is evaluated using clustering algorithms. When the<br> image is pre-processed, contrast of the image is enhanced. The resulting enhanced image is<br> clustered using the effective clustering algorithms. Figure 3 represents the input image for WML<br> detection. In order to increase robustness, the noisy medical image is pre-processed. Figure 4<br> depicts the pre-processed image. Bright contrast stretching, which is one of the image enhancement<br> (pre-processing) techniques is applied. After pre-processing the enhanced image is subjected to<br> clustering. Three clustering models are proposed to provide accurate results.</p> <p>All scans obtained from different image clustering models are manually ranked based on<br> values in table 1. Table 2 represents WML detection rates of optimized images. FCM, GPC and<br> GFCM clustering methods and hybrid optimized methods (FCM-PSO, GPC-PSO and GFCM-PSO)<br> are applied on a dataset of 208 images and ranking is done in terms of under detected, over<br> detected, properly detected as shown in figure 8 and figure 9. The number of images detected<br> properly in GFCM is comparatively high than FCM and GPC.</p>

Allen Brain Atlas

Allen Brain Atlas is an Allen Institute collection of brain map atlases, datasets, APIs, and analysis tools covering mouse, human, and non-human primate brain resources.

International Brain Laboratory public data

The International Brain Laboratory public data releases expose standardized mouse decision-making experiments, including Neuropixels recordings, widefield calcium imaging, behavior, and session metadata accessed through the ONE API.
